E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
C3P0连接池
为什么数据库
连接池
不采用 IO 多路复用?
最近在思考低代码平台存储数据的连接数问题,考虑到这个点,然后思考以及搜索整理了下为什么数据库
连接池
不采用IO多路复用?IO多路复用被视为是非常好的性能助力器。
·
2023-04-20 13:19
c3p0
报错java.lang.NoClassDefFoundError: com/mchange/v2/ser/Indirector
1.问题由来今天第一次学习到
c3p0
的时候,学习资料上使用的是0.9.1.2版本。我偷懒使用的是0.9.2版本。
什么香香脆脆我们最爱
·
2023-04-20 11:11
java
java
intellij-idea
开发语言
Hikari创建连接的时机
在连接关闭closeConnection()的时候,会调用fillPool()进行填充到minimumIdle个连接HikariPool
连接池
初始化在
连接池
初始化时,会开启HouseKeeper去定时检查
holysu
·
2023-04-20 07:44
【并发编程】线程池的原理和源码分析
那么就会有以下问题需要频繁的创建和销毁线程,需要消耗CPU资源如果创建和销毁的线程的数量过多(大于CPU核数),那么线程之间需要不断的进行上下文切换,会消耗CPU资源所以我们需要对线程做一个复用池化技术的核心:复用eg.
连接池
dearfulan
·
2023-04-20 07:57
并发编程
java
jvm
算法
redis使用bitop的一种业务场景
具体实现如下:1.创建一个Redis
连接池
import("github.com/gomodule/redigo/redis")varredisPool*redis.Poolfuncinit(){redisPool
gitxuzan_
·
2023-04-20 07:56
golang
redis
不得不说的创建型模式-单例模式
单例模式通常用于管理共享资源,如配置文件、数据库
连接池
等,它可以保证这些资源只被创建一次,并且可以被全局共享。
五百五。
·
2023-04-20 06:06
设计模式
c++
工厂方法模式
单例模式
【Redis】Java客户端操作reids数据库
目录一、Java客户端分类1、Jedis2、lettuce3、Redisson二、Jedis三、reids
连接池
一、Java客户端分类Redis提供了多个版本的Java客户端,其中推荐使用Jedis、lettuce
1373i
·
2023-04-20 04:17
Redis
Java
数据库
java
redis
JAVA简历1到三年
3.熟练MySQL的增删改查操作以及JDBC数据库
连接池
的使用。4.熟悉Git这种分布式版本的控制系统的使用。5.熟悉S
Java&Develop
·
2023-04-20 03:43
java开发简历
Java开发
java
Okhttp
连接池
一、ConnectInterceptor拦截器okhttp
连接池
与链路ConnectInterceptor拦截器,intercept()方法,创建Network链路。
gczxbb
·
2023-04-20 03:06
JMeter-JDBC Request使用
进行请求,下面针对两个配置进行摘录JDBCConnectionConfiguration配置VariableNameBoundtoPool:元素功能VariableNameforcreatedpool数据库
连接池
名称
流墨馨
·
2023-04-20 02:05
测试工具的使用
压力测试
扫描测试工具
数据库
连接池
的大小你真的设置对了吗
问题真实环境prod中的系统,我们该如何设置数据库
连接池
的大小呢?一些所谓的开发老鸟可能会肯定的告诉你:没关系,尽量设置的大些,比如设置成200,这样数据库性能会高些,吞吐量也会大些!
漂漂欲仙
·
2023-04-20 02:07
数据库
数据库
oracle
java
池技术:
连接池
,线程池,内存池,进程池等汇总分析
引言在软件开发中,经常会遇到需要频繁创建和销毁某些资源的情况。这些资源可能是内存、线程、数据库连接等。频繁地创建和销毁资源可能导致性能下降和资源浪费。为了解决这些问题,软件开发者设计了一种称为“池技术”的策略。本文将介绍池技术的由来、原理、优缺点以及常见的池技术类型。池技术的由来和目的池技术起源于对计算机资源管理的需求。在计算机系统中,资源(如内存、线程、进程、连接等)的分配和回收是关键性能因素。
G探险者
·
2023-04-20 02:06
java
java
大数据
数据库
【java】池技术--
连接池
线程池 内存池 进程池等汇总分析
文章目录一、引言二、池技术的由来和目的三、池技术的原理四、池技术的优缺点五、常见的池技术类型七、延伸与拓展八、结论一、引言在软件开发中,经常会遇到需要频繁创建和销毁某些资源的情况。这些资源可能是内存、线程、数据库连接等。频繁地创建和销毁资源可能导致性能下降和资源浪费。为了解决这些问题,软件开发者设计了一种称为“池技术”的策略。本文将介绍池技术的由来、原理、优缺点以及常见的池技术类型。二、池技术的由
逆流°只是风景-bjhxcc
·
2023-04-20 01:33
Java程序员进阶之路
java
大数据
15个使用率超高的Python库,下载量均过亿
线程安全
连接池
客户端SSL/TLS验证使用multipart编码进行文件上传用于重传请求并处理HTTP重定向的辅助功能支持gzip和deflate编码
菜鸟学Python
·
2023-04-20 01:11
python
爬虫
开发语言
3.从nacos配置中心读取mysql数据源DataSource
1.因为druid存在
连接池
泄露。
哈喽,树先生
·
2023-04-20 01:25
mybatis
mysql
java
spring
boot
数据库
连接池
之Druid
/*Druid数据库
连接池
演示*/publicclassDruidDemo{pu
居明明
·
2023-04-19 23:08
JavaWeb
数据库
mysql
spring
国内外开源商城系统盘点
主要目的是充分发挥Java在缓存、多线程、数据库
连接池
等方面的优势提高OpenCart性能。▲Shop
Moon_dcf7
·
2023-04-19 23:02
万字长文手写数据库
连接池
,让抽象工厂不再抽象
本文节选自《设计模式就该这样学》1关于产品等级结构和产品族在讲解抽象工厂之前,我们要了解两个概念:产品等级结构和产品族,如下图所示。file上图中有正方形、圆形和菱形3种图形,相同颜色、相同深浅的代表同一个产品族,相同形状的代表同一个产品等级结构。同样可以从生活中来举例,比如,美的电器生产多种家用电器,那么上图中,颜色最深的正方形就代表美的洗衣机,颜色最深的圆形代表美的空调,颜色最深的菱形代表美的
Tom弹架构
·
2023-04-19 22:23
HikariPool
连接池
初始化
HikariPool
连接池
在初始化的时候主要做了几件事:初始化底层的连接容器ConcurrentBagcheckFailFast()尝试创建一个db连接,如果失败则直接抛出初始化异常中断初始化初始化各类资源
holysu
·
2023-04-19 17:30
Java-阶段学习总结
阶段学习总结学习总结问题学习总结这一阶段我学习了数据库的有关知识点以及相关操作,学习了数据库
连接池
的有关应用以及知识点,学习了Tomcat,Servlet和jsp以及Cookie和Session,还有EL
池北鱼
·
2023-04-19 16:37
笔记
java
springBoot数据库
连接池
常用配置
在配置文件中添加配置如下(我使用的是多数据源):spring.datasource.primary.url=jdbc\:mysql\://localhost\:3306/test?useUnicode\=true&characterEncoding\=utf-8spring.datasource.primary.username=testspring.datasource.primary.pass
newbiebird
·
2023-04-19 16:52
spring
boot
mysql
mysql
数据
Jdbc开发结构
一、导入jar包,放置lib目录下,需要的有:(1)alibaba
连接池
(druid)(2)apache工具类(commons-dbutils)(2)数据库连接包(mysql-connection-java
林先生
·
2023-04-19 16:47
java
apache
mysql
JavaWeb开发 —— MyBatis入门
目录一、快速入门程序二、配置SQL提示三、JDBC四、数据库
连接池
五、lombok工具包MyBatis是一款优秀的持久层Dao层框架,用于简化JDBC的开发。
Hgngy.
·
2023-04-19 16:01
JavaWeb开发
mybatis
java
intellij-idea
在Linux上查看活跃线程数与连接数
简介现如今,有两种常见的软件资源几乎成了Java后端程序的标配,即线程池与
连接池
,但这些池化资源非常的重要,一旦不够用了,就会导致程序阻塞、性能低下,所以有时我们需要看看它们的使用情况,以判断这里是否是瓶颈
·
2023-04-19 15:36
linuxjava线程池连接池
TCP长连接的
连接池
、容量控制与心跳保活
一、长连接与短连接TCP本身并没有长短连接的区别,长短与否,完全取决于我们怎么用它。短连接:每次通信时,创建Socket;一次通信结束,调用socket.close()。这就是一般意义上的短连接,短连接的好处是管理起来比较简单,存在的连接都是可用的连接,不需要额外的控制手段。长连接:每次通信完毕后,不会关闭连接,这样就可以做到连接的复用。长连接的好处便是省去了创建连接的耗时。想要简单,不追求高性能
Leread
·
2023-04-19 14:07
深入浅出网络协议
tcp/ip
网络
java
java单机秒杀扛1万并发方案和代码
我们先来看普通的加锁加事务秒杀性能,说明:1.这里的秒杀业务执行一次耗时100毫秒2.电脑配置16g内存4核8线程cpui77代,数据库
连接池
max=20@RequestMapping("/purchase2
请把小熊还给我&
·
2023-04-19 11:04
java
数据库
开发语言
项目优化的方法(渲染优化)
禁止使用iframe(阻塞父文档onload事件)iframe会阻塞主页面的Onload事件搜索引擎的检索程序无法解读这种页面,不利于SEOiframe和主页面共享
连接池
,而浏览器对相同域的连接有限制,
不拿Offer不改名
·
2023-04-19 11:36
javascript
前端
开发语言
[druid 源码解析] 2 初始化
连接池
1.1SpringAutoConfig对于一个SpringBootStarter我们都会从他的spring.factories开始看起,因为这里定义了其配置类信息,我们找到如下配置类DruidDataSourceAutoConfigure:org.springframework.boot.autoconfigure.EnableAutoConfiguration=\com.alibaba.drui
AndyWei123
·
2023-04-19 08:40
【已解决】IDEA程序包com.mchange.v2.
c3p0
不存在解决方法
IDEA程序包com.mchange.v2.
c3p0
不存在解决方法解决方法:右键项目-Maven-Reimport:如图
19Java菜鸟
·
2023-04-19 07:10
Java
intellij-idea
maven
java
面试题:互联网三高解决思路
在这两个维度下还有三高:(1)高可用(2)高性能(3)高扩展1.1高性能解决思路:缓存(分布式缓存,本地缓存)地理位置相关(GSLB,异地多活,单元化,让用户更容易访问到数据)读写分离同步变异步串行改并行池化技术(线程池
连接池
酆都小菜鬼
·
2023-04-19 04:54
JAVA系统设计
java
02-数据库
连接池
+lombok工具
数据库
连接池
概念:数据库
连接池
是个容器,负责分配、管理数据库连接(Connection)它允许应用程序重复使用一个现有的数据库连接,而不是重新建立一个释放空闲时间超过最大空闲时间的连接,来避免因为没有释放连接而引起的数据库连接遗漏优势
糊糊熊猫
·
2023-04-19 04:50
Mybatis
数据库
mysql
sql
Mysql——》架构分层 && 模块
Connector:支持各种语言和SQL的交互(PHP、Python)ManagementServeices&Utilities:系统管理和控制工具(备份恢复、Mysql复制)ConnectionPool:
连接池
小仙。
·
2023-04-19 01:33
Mysql
mysql
架构
执行
分层
设计模式之单例模式
缺点:不适用于变化频繁的对象;滥用单例将带来一些负面问题,如为了节省资源将数据库
连接池
对象设计为的单例类,可能会导致共享
连接池
对象的程序过多而出现
连接池
溢出;如果实例化
Mr.JunJun
·
2023-04-19 01:52
单例模式
设计模式
java
从
连接池
的角度阅读 database/sql 包的源码
本文首发于HyGao的个人博客,未经允许请勿转载前言golang标准库中的database/sql包提供了一种数据库的抽象,这种抽象面向接口,所以与具体的数据库无关。这意味着,开发人员几乎可以使用同一套代码来使用不同的数据库,只需要导入对应的数据库驱动即可,而这个所谓的驱动其实就是实现了database/sql中的接口的外部库。这里不对database/sql中接口的层级关系做介绍,感兴趣的朋友可
·
2023-04-18 22:18
gosql连接池
named-config with name ‘
c3p0
-config.xml‘ does not exist. Using default-config
那一定是你的问题配置文件的名称为
c3p0
-config.xml,报的错误信息也是一直在说这个文件找不到。你我都以为代码没问题,xml文件没问题。
NV_li_JCF
·
2023-04-18 22:11
java测试开发
sql
数据库
连接池
HikariPool (二) - 获取及关闭连接
获取数据库连接是通过DataSource发起的,如果应用使用HikariPool作为
连接池
的话,需要配置DataSource为HikariDataSource,应用通过调用HikariDataSource
·
2023-04-18 22:21
【Java版oj】day37数据库
连接池
、mkdir
目录一、数据库
连接池
(1)原题再现(2)问题分析(3)完整代码二、mkdir(1)原题再现(2)问题分析(3)完整代码一、数据库
连接池
(1)原题再现数据库
连接池
__牛客网Web系统通常会频繁地访问数据库
小熊爱吃软糖吖
·
2023-04-18 22:29
我是小小做题酱
java
算法
开发语言
牛客
刷题
1-Mysql架构分析
3.ConnectionPoolmysql
连接池
,接收请求,建立连接。4.SqlInterfaceSQL接口接受用户命令,执行后续操作,并且返回SQL的操作结果。
zPeet
·
2023-04-18 21:58
Mysql学习笔记
mysql
架构
JDBC之自定义
连接池
目录数据库
连接池
自定义
连接池
1、开发步骤2、开发过程2.1准备工作2.2代码2.2.1工具类2.2.2
连接池
实现类2.2.3测试类2.3代码优化一2.3.1修改JDBCUtils2.4使用装饰器模式2.4.1
PP东
·
2023-04-18 20:56
Java
数据库
java
sql
requests-html
地址中文文档手册,刚发现的安装pipinstallrequests-html可能会报错,重复装几次全面支持解析JavaScriptCSS选择器.XPath选择器自定义user-agent自动追踪重定向.
连接池
与
白白_嫩嫩
·
2023-04-18 19:33
nginx中lua-redis使用
对lua-resty-redis进行了二次封装,封装了开箱即用的
连接池
,每次Redis使用完毕,自动释放Red
PONY LEE
·
2023-04-18 19:17
nginx
lua
lua
redis
nginx
Spring Boot集成Mybatis 入门第二篇
接上篇,首先,把druid
连接池
Jar包的引用添加到pom.xml文件里com.alibabadruid1.1.0如果你在上篇的搭建中有把mybatisjar包引用路径屏蔽掉的话,在这里也要放开。
Time大王
·
2023-04-18 14:57
事务&数据库
连接池
&DBUtils
事务Transaction其实指的一组操作,里面包含许多个单一的逻辑。只要有一个逻辑没有执行成功,那么都算失败。所有的数据都回归到最初的状态(回滚)事务的作用:为了确保逻辑的成功。例子:银行的转账。使用命令行方式演示事务。关闭自动提交功能。关闭自动提交开启事务starttransaction;开启事务提交或者回滚事务:事务提交后或者回滚就结束了commit;提交事务,数据将会写到磁盘上的数据库co
hgzzz
·
2023-04-18 13:25
[Swoole] PHP7+Mysql+Redis+tp5+swoole+laravel项目到架构公开课 [MP4/WMV] (8.4G)
延迟任务队列-peter│05-14直播│3-09excel│3-1微信弹幕│3-20并发解决方案│3-23机器学习│3-27php爬虫│3-6php大话设计模式│5-04RBAC权限│5-08数据库
连接池
xiaonu
·
2023-04-18 12:56
IDEA常用高效开发工具——screw一键生成数据库文档
一键生成数据库文档,从此告别人工整理文档]a:数据库支持:MySQLMariaDBTIDBOracleSqlServerPostgreSQLCacheDBb:配置引入screw核心包,HikariCP数据库
连接池
栽树先生~
·
2023-04-18 09:37
#
高效开发工具篇
java
idea
核心源码分析:数据库短时断开Druid
连接池
如何恢复连接
文章目录前言Druid简介Druid
连接池
如何恢复连接获取连接超时和检查连接机制创建连接重试机制生产环境如何配置
连接池
保证高可用写在最后前言在我们常用的应用软件中都会用到数据库,数据库是提供数据保证系统正常运行的基础
小沈同学呀
·
2023-04-18 07:27
database
数据库
运维
数据库连接池
druid
数据库
连接池
连接数10?100?1000?的困惑
1.开篇闲谈闲暇之余看到一篇博文:如何正确设置数据库
连接池
的大小?我的天,原来之前都设置错了!基本上来说,大部分项目都需要跟数据库做交互,那么,数据库
连接池
的大小设置成多大合适呢?
BeautifulHao
·
2023-04-18 05:50
ssm项目改造spring boot项目完整步骤
目录添加依赖添加启动类拷贝项目代码配置数据库
连接池
添加依赖
连接池
的自动配置方式配置Druid
连接池
集成MyBatis添加依赖配置Mapper对象MyBatis配置属性事务管理添加依赖注解方式配置切换代理测试验证集成
·
2023-04-18 01:34
新手也能看懂的线程池学习总结
一使用线程池的好处池化技术相比大家已经屡见不鲜了,线程池、数据库
连接池
、Http
连接池
等等都是对这个思想的应用。池化技术的思想主要是为了减少每次获取资源的消耗,提高对资源的利用率。
xiaomage9527
·
2023-04-18 01:26
精通线程池,看这一篇就够了
当然有,和我们以前学习过多
连接池
技术类似,线程池通过提前创建好线程保存在线程池中,在任务要执行时取出,任务结束时再放回去,由此大大提高线程利用率,避免频繁创建销毁带来的开销二:Java提供的线程池有哪些那么我们怎么才能创建一个线程池呢
每天都在学习的狮子座程序员
·
2023-04-17 19:38
java
jvm
算法
上一页
43
44
45
46
47
48
49
50
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他